This test measures the availability of thyroid hormone-binding proteins in the bloodstream rather than the amount of thyroid hormone itself. T-Uptake helps estimate how much thyroid hormone is bound to proteins and how much remains available for use by the body.
Diagnostic Value: T-Uptake is commonly performed alongside Total T4 to help assess thyroid function and calculate the Free Thyroxine Index (FTI), providing a more accurate evaluation of thyroid hormone status.
Clinical Significance: Abnormal T-Uptake results may reflect changes in thyroid-binding proteins rather than thyroid disease itself. Elevated T-Uptake is often associated with hyperthyroidism or reduced binding proteins, while decreased T-Uptake may occur with hypothyroidism, pregnancy, estrogen therapy, or increased thyroid-binding proteins.
Symptom Correlation: Changes in T-Uptake alone typically do not cause symptoms but help explain abnormal thyroid hormone test results. When interpreted with Total T4 and TSH, it assists in identifying conditions associated with fatigue, weight changes, temperature intolerance, and altered heart rate.
